ALEXANDRIA, Va., Oct.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,456,574, issued on Oct. 28, was assigned to IHI Corp. (Tokyo).

"Coil device" was invented by Kenji Nishimura (Tokyo) and Susumu Tokura (Tokyo).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A coil device includes a main unit in which a coil that wirelessly transmits or receives electric power is accommodated in a main housing fixed to an installation target, and a sub-unit in which an electrical function unit that provides the main unit with an electrical function performed by at least one of an electric component and an electronic component is accommodated in a sub-housing detachably configured to be attached to the main housing.
